C# Class OSharp.Autofac.Mvc.MvcAutofacIocBuilder

Mvc-Autofac依赖注入初始化类
Inheritance: OSharp.Core.Dependency.IocBuilderBase
Show file Open project: i66soft/osharp Class Usage Examples

Public Methods

Method Description
MvcAutofacIocBuilder ( IServiceCollection services ) : System

初始化一个MvcAutofacIocBuilder类型的新实例

Protected Methods

Method Description
AddCustomTypes ( IServiceCollection services ) : void

添加自定义服务映射

BuildAndSetResolver ( IServiceCollection services, Assembly assemblies ) : IServiceProvider

构建服务并设置MVC平台的Resolver

Method Details

AddCustomTypes() protected method

添加自定义服务映射
protected AddCustomTypes ( IServiceCollection services ) : void
services IServiceCollection 服务信息集合
return void

BuildAndSetResolver() protected method

构建服务并设置MVC平台的Resolver
protected BuildAndSetResolver ( IServiceCollection services, Assembly assemblies ) : IServiceProvider
services IServiceCollection 服务映射信息集合
assemblies System.Reflection.Assembly 程序集集合
return IServiceProvider

MvcAutofacIocBuilder() public method

初始化一个MvcAutofacIocBuilder类型的新实例
public MvcAutofacIocBuilder ( IServiceCollection services ) : System
services IServiceCollection 服务信息集合
return System